Sandeep Singh elevated to Quasar Media biz head
MUMBAI: Quasar Media has elevated Sandeep Singh as business head brand and media solutions for its operations in Delhi, Mumbai and Bangalore.
In his new role, Singh will be reporting to Quasar Media co-founder Manish Vij.
Under his new mandate, Singh will be responsible to grow the brand and media business inorganically in India and increase its market share.
Quasar Media‘s business director West Moneka Khurana, regional head North Piyush Rathi and regional head South Ajay Gupta will report to Singh.
Prior to this, he was Quasar business director and managing operations in Mumbai and Bangalore. Singh has been associated with Quasar Media for the last five years.
Prior to this, he was with Rediff.com media sales team.

Dish TV shareholders approve three independent directors
99.49 per cent vote of confidence strengthens board as company expands into connected TV, e-commerce and OTT.
MUMBAI: Dish TV has just been served a near-perfect vote of confidence and the shareholders have dished it out in style. Shareholders of the DTH operator have approved the appointment of three new Independent Directors with an overwhelming 99.49 per cent approval. The three appointees are Mr Arun Kumar Kapoor, Ms Heena Naishadh Bhatt and Mr Ashok Anant Paranjpe.
The strong mandate reflects continued investor faith in the company’s strategy, disciplined execution and long-term value creation. It comes as Dish TV focuses on stabilising its core DTH business while actively scaling new verticals connected TV platform VZY, B2B e-commerce ShopZop, and OTT service Watcho to build a more diversified and resilient growth trajectory.
Dish TV India Limited, CEO & executive director Manoj Dhobhal said, “We are encouraged by the shareholders’ approval of the appointment of the Independent Directors and sincerely thank them for their continued trust and confidence. The Board is already benefiting from the Directors’ collective experience, which will further sharpen strategic focus and support disciplined execution.”
